S10狀態(tài)繼電器在三菱PLC中究竟扮演什么角色?為什么它在自動(dòng)化系統(tǒng)中不可或缺?
對(duì)于從事工業(yè)控制系統(tǒng)的工程師來(lái)說(shuō),了解并掌握三菱PLC中的S10狀態(tài)繼電器是實(shí)現(xiàn)復(fù)雜邏輯控制的基礎(chǔ)之一。作為狀態(tài)控制的重要元件,S10狀態(tài)繼電器主要用于程序運(yùn)行過(guò)程中標(biāo)志位的設(shè)定和傳遞,其合理使用能夠有效提高控制流程的清晰度與執(zhí)行效率。
S10狀態(tài)繼電器的基本作用
S10狀態(tài)繼電器本質(zhì)上是一種內(nèi)部軟元件,用于表示某個(gè)特定狀態(tài)是否被激活。它不直接參與外部設(shè)備的驅(qū)動(dòng),而是作為程序內(nèi)部邏輯判斷的“信號(hào)旗”。
常見(jiàn)的用途包括:
– 標(biāo)記某一工藝流程階段已完成
– 控制步進(jìn)順序的切換條件
– 作為故障或報(bào)警狀態(tài)的記錄節(jié)點(diǎn)
這類(lèi)繼電器通常與步進(jìn)指令(如STL)配合使用,構(gòu)成結(jié)構(gòu)清晰的狀態(tài)轉(zhuǎn)移圖,便于程序維護(hù)與調(diào)試。
S10狀態(tài)繼電器的使用場(chǎng)景
工藝流程控制
在多步驟的流水線(xiàn)控制中,S10狀態(tài)繼電器可作為各階段之間的銜接標(biāo)記。例如,在包裝機(jī)械中,當(dāng)上一工序完成時(shí),觸發(fā)對(duì)應(yīng)的狀態(tài)繼電器,進(jìn)而啟動(dòng)下一階段的動(dòng)作。
故障與異常管理
在設(shè)備發(fā)生異常時(shí),系統(tǒng)可通過(guò)置位特定的狀態(tài)繼電器來(lái)記錄事件,并觸發(fā)相應(yīng)的保護(hù)機(jī)制。這種做法不僅有助于故障排查,還能確保程序在復(fù)位后恢復(fù)到安全狀態(tài)。
多任務(wù)協(xié)調(diào)處理
面對(duì)多個(gè)子程序并行運(yùn)行的情況,狀態(tài)繼電器可以作為任務(wù)之間通信的橋梁。通過(guò)監(jiān)測(cè)彼此的狀態(tài)標(biāo)志,不同模塊之間能更有效地協(xié)同工作,避免沖突和資源競(jìng)爭(zhēng)。
使用S10狀態(tài)繼電器的注意事項(xiàng)
盡管S10狀態(tài)繼電器功能強(qiáng)大,但在實(shí)際編程中仍需注意以下幾點(diǎn):
– 避免重復(fù)使用同一狀態(tài)編號(hào):這可能導(dǎo)致邏輯混亂,影響程序穩(wěn)定性。
– 及時(shí)復(fù)位狀態(tài)標(biāo)志:防止殘留狀態(tài)干擾后續(xù)流程。
– 與普通輔助繼電器區(qū)分開(kāi)來(lái):S10系列專(zhuān)為狀態(tài)控制設(shè)計(jì),不宜混用作通用中間變量。
上海工品致力于為客戶(hù)提供穩(wěn)定可靠的工業(yè)控制元件及技術(shù)支持,幫助企業(yè)在智能制造轉(zhuǎn)型過(guò)程中實(shí)現(xiàn)高效、穩(wěn)定的自動(dòng)化解決方案。
總結(jié):
S10狀態(tài)繼電器作為三菱PLC編程中的核心元件之一,在流程控制、故障管理和多任務(wù)協(xié)調(diào)方面發(fā)揮著重要作用。理解其工作原理與應(yīng)用場(chǎng)景,不僅能提升編程效率,也有助于構(gòu)建更加穩(wěn)健的控制系統(tǒng)架構(gòu)。